Transaction 41ab17ba3d053eb052caf907fc0bb5dfdca8f7a43f764cd62069016abc1f47aa
1 Input
2 Outputs
- 41ab17ba3d053eb052caf907fc0bb5dfdca8f7a43f764cd62069016abc1f47aa:0
- 41ab17ba3d053eb052caf907fc0bb5dfdca8f7a43f764cd62069016abc1f47aa:1
value 3000000
address 3QdW1ZKYXRnxB7TaYeYkesmndodDFZtXGX
value 679954
address 159FmJAgK6MkJHUVDfCtyCJnq3T6JLaF4u